    Anyhoo, when I was a real little guy, both Mabu from Rolling Thunder and Jaquio from Ninja Gaiden gave me the uber-willies. They don't have that effect on me now, but the bejeezus was scared out of me the first time I played Final Fantasy VII... Hojo's experiments in Cloud's flashback. Holy shiat... I forget exactly what they looked like. Every subsequent time I played FFVII, I closed my eyes, so I only saw them once. Yeah, I am SUCH a pansy.

    Anyone have a photo of those things? I could go for a good scare right about now. Another creepy thing was Jennifer in Splatterhouse 3... if you didn't work fast enough in Stage 2, you are 'treated' to a horribly distorted photo of Jennifer's face, altered by the boreworm within her. It ain't pretty. I only saw it once. From then on, I had no desire to screw up badly on stage 2 ever again.
